Families and employees are grieving the loss of lives and coping with the impact of the destruction caused by the recent UPS plane crash. As the community begins to process the tragedy, local businesses affected by the incident are slowly working towards recovery.
The crash, which occurred just a week ago, not only claimed lives but also left a significant mark on the local economy. Many businesses in the vicinity experienced disruptions and a decline in customer traffic as residents grappled with the emotional toll of the event.
Support has poured in from neighboring communities, with various initiatives aimed at assisting those directly impacted. Local organizations are stepping up to provide resources for families dealing with loss, while businesses are collaborating to promote recovery efforts.
As the community comes together to support one another, there is a shared hope that healing will come with time, and that the resilience of the people will shine through in the face of adversity.
